Home » Restaurants » UK » Birmingham Restaurants » Omar Khayam Indian Restaurant Northfield Birmingham (Fully Licensed) | 711 Bristol Rd S Northfield Birmingham B31 2JT United Kingdom

Omar Khayam Indian Restaurant Northfield Birmingham (Fully Licensed) | 711 Bristol Rd S Northfield Birmingham B31 2JT United Kingdom Restaurant Menu & Phone

Restaurant Reviews:

137
4.4/5

Omar Khayam Indian Restaurant Northfield Birmingham (Fully Licensed) | 711 Bristol Rd S Northfield Birmingham B31 2JT United Kingdom Contact Details

711 Bristol Rd S Northfield Birmingham B31 2JT United Kingdom

Related Restaurants